Forum82 "repertorylevel" File Inclusion Vulnerabilities
Secunia Advisory: SA22214
Release Date: 2006-10-02
Last Update: 2006-10-05
Popularity: 4,213 views

Critical:
Highly critical
Impact: System access
Where: From remote
Solution Status: Vendor Patch

Software:Forum82 2.x

Subscribe: Instant alerts on relevant vulnerabilities

CVE reference:CVE-2006-5148


Description:
Silahsiz Kuvvetler has discovered some vulnerabilities in Forum82, which can be exploited by malicious people to compromise a vulnerable system.

Input passed to the "repertorylevel" parameter in various files is not properly verified before being used to include files. This can be exploited to include arbitrary files from local or external resources.

The vulnerabilities have been confirmed in version 2.5.2. Other versions may also be affected.

Solution:
Update to version 2.5.4.
